      The square root of 112 is actually a non-integer, which can be expressed as either a decimal (10.49284977) or a surd (√112). This is because there is no whole number that multiplies by itself to give 112.

      The square root of a number is a mathematical operation that finds the value of a number that, when multiplied by itself, gives the original number. For example, the square root of 16 is 4, because 4 multiplied by 4 equals 16. In the case of the square root of 112, the value is a bit more complex, but it's still based on the same principle.
